60 Moody St, Burnie is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1953. The property has a land size of 572m2 and floor size of 104m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 2024.
Nestled on the outskirts of the Burnie CBD and offering timeless charm and breathtaking water views. It?s red brick fa?ade has the classic appeal, complemented by an open-concept interior with an abundant natural light.
Central galley-style kitchen has been updated and has a real homey feel with the glass door leading out to the back of the property. Bathroom is very tidy and the two generous and robed bedrooms provide comfort and beautiful views.

The size of Burnie is approximately 1.4 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 7.6% of total area. The population of Burnie in 2016 was 596 people. By 2021 the population was 693 showing a population growth of 16.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Burnie is 20-29 years. Households in Burnie are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Burnie work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 48.30% of the homes in Burnie were owner-occupied compared with 46.30% in 2016.
